A good one is 'Schindler's List' in book form. It details the true story of Oskar Schindler, a German businessman who saved the lives of many Jews. 'The Rape of Nanking' is also a significant book. It reveals the brutal and often - overlooked true story of the Nanking Massacre during World War 2. Then there's 'Maus' which uses a unique graphic novel format to tell the true story of the author's father's experiences in the Holocaust.
